I'm also having problems with USB on RPi5. Now it's not quite the same problem as the thread creator, but lately some USB sticks don't work anymore and crash the machine. They have worked before. I have the real power adapter from RPi5. 5V/5A. The USB sticks that crash are Sandisk Extreme Pro 128GB and Samsung bar plus 128GB.

I have tried to rewrite the SD card and also tested with several SD cards. Also another RPi5 with the same problem. Now I'm testing Ubuntu 23.10. There they work as they should. So something is wrong with any update that has come out lately. I have the latest default EEPROM that came out on 2024-02-16 if it is of any use.

have you set

usb_max_current_enable=1

in config.txt?

I wouldn't have thought that USB sticks would be consuming much power; but still, worth a try. I have used the same sticks on my 5, without any issues.
